Transaction 1efd1bae2bc81e5cf94f89b02f88243182b449b51aaa9ddc88f718cd99e10978

12 Input
1 Outputs
  • 1efd1bae2bc81e5cf94f89b02f88243182b449b51aaa9ddc88f718cd99e10978:0
  • value  389074040
    address  bc1qthk3c5ljzyc3085je702tkswhz32rh5z0nw5ca